Decree on extension of sanctions against Russian citizens and companies will come into force on Oct 31
The decree of President of Ukraine Petro Poroshenko, enacting the decision of the National Security and Defense Council dated September 16, 2016 on application of special personal economic and other restrictive measures (sanctions), will enter into force on October 31, 2016.
"The decree will enter into force on October 31, 2016," reads presidential decree No. 467/2016 on the website of the Verkhovna Rada.
According to the norms valid in Ukraine, laws and other acts of the Verkhovna Rada of regulatory nature take effect in ten calendar days after the official publication unless otherwise stipulated by the laws or regulations but not prior to official promulgation. The same norm is provided for presidential decrees.
